***Ophiocantabria*** is an extinct genus of [brittle stars](/source/Brittle_star) that lived during the early [Devonian period](/source/Devonian) in what is now the [Furada Formation](/source/Furada_Formation) of [Spain](/source/Spain). It contains a single species, ***O. elegans***, which was first described in 2015 from a complete specimen.

## Discovery and naming

The only known specimen of *Ophiocantabria* was collected in the village of [El Fresno](/source/El_Fresno_(Grado)), located in the [Cantabrian Mountains](/source/Cantabrian_Mountains) of northern Spain. The deposits from which the fossil originates represents a poorly-exposed section of the [Furada Formation](/source/Furada_Formation) covered partly by vegetation, which dates to the early [Lochkovian](/source/Lochkovian) stage of the [Devonian](/source/Devonian) period. In 2015, paleontologists Daniel Blake, Samuel Zamora and Jenaro Garcia-Alcalde described a new genus and species based on this specimen, which they named *Ophiocantabria elegans*. The [generic name](/source/Generic_name_(biology)) references the Cantabrian Mountains where the fossil was discovered, while the [specific name](/source/Specific_name_(zoology)) is [Latin](/source/Latin) for "elegant". The only known specimen of this species has been designated as the [holotype](/source/Holotype), and is housed in the geology museum of the [University of Oviedo](/source/University_of_Oviedo) where it is cataloged as DPO 33484.[1]
